Life Chain To Be Held Sunday, Oct. 6 In O'Neill

O'Neill's Life Chain will be held from 2-3 p.m. on Sunday, Oct. 6. Registration begins at 1:30 p.m. at the corner of 3rd and Douglas. 

Participants will pick up signs and prayer sheets when they register, then join the lines on both sides of Douglas St. and spend an hour in silent witness while praying for the end of abortion. 

Everyone who believes legalized abortion kills children, hurts women, and needs prayers to be defeated is invited to join this ecumenical prayer vigil.

This year there is a heightened need for prayer, due to the amendments to the state constitution on the ballot in November, according to Boyd Holt Right to Life.

The Protect Our Right to Abortion amendment, measure 439, reads: All persons shall have a fundamental right to abortion until fetal viability, or when needed to protect the life or health of the pregnant patient, without interference from the state or its political subdivisions. Fetal viability means the point in pregnancy when, in the professional judgement of the patient's treating health care practitioner, there is a significant likelihood of the fetus' sustained survival outside the uterus without the application of extraordinary medical measures. 

Kristin New, a licensed mental health therapist in Omaha, who used to work for an abortion clinic, feels the language is intentionally vague. “It feels like a manipulative attempt to make things foggy so that people don't really know what it is that they're voting for.” 

She is concerned about the definition of ‘fetal viability' and who would determine that. There is no requirement that the ‘treating healthcare practitioner' be a doctor.

The amendment's definition of ‘viability' does not depend on a gestational age, it depends on whether the baby needs medical supports to survive outside the womb. Any aged baby needing NICU care could be deemed nonviable, by the treating healthcare practitioner, who could be the abortionist, according to New. New's own views on abortion changed after she witnessed an ultrasound of a second-trimester as it was performed. 

Measure 434 reads: Except when a woman seeks an abortion necessitated by medical emergency or when the pregnancy results from sexual assault or incest, unborn children shall be protected from abortion in the second and third trimester. It does not establish a right to abortion in Nebraska's state constitution.
